I think for the most part, games sold in Australia are published by International / foreign publishers. Fallout 3 for example is published by Bethesda Softworks, a division of ZeniMax Europe. By the bar-code it says "Made in the EU". Red Ant are the Australian distributors. I'm pretty sure you can look at the chain of command as Developer > Publisher > Distributor > Retailer. Somebody correct me if I'm wrong at any part of this or about the specifics of Fallout 3 or Red Ant.

So yeah, I think if Red Ant went under, retailers could run out of stock of Fallout 3 (and others) since a distributor isn't in place.
